Gabor Maté is not a self-help influencer.
He is a globally respected physician and best-selling author with over 40 years of clinical experience in trauma, addiction, stress, and mind-body healing.
Born in 1944 during the Holocaust, Dr. Maté’s early experiences with trauma shaped his lifelong mission: to understand how our past shapes our health, our emotions, and our lives.
He spent decades working as a family doctor and treating patients with addiction and chronic illness in Vancouver’s Downtown Eastside, one of the most marginalized neighborhoods in North America.
Through this work, he redefined the conversation around trauma and addiction—not as problems to be fixed, but as adaptations to deep emotional pain.
His bestselling books, including In the Realm of Hungry Ghosts, When the Body Says No, and The Myth of Normal (co-written with his son Daniel Maté), have inspired millions and reshaped how we think about healing.

Bessel van der Kolk is not a motivational speaker.
He is one of the most influential psychiatrists and trauma researchers in the world - and the man who helped change how modern medicine understands trauma.
For over 40 years, Dr. van der Kolk has worked with survivors of abuse, violence, war, and childhood trauma, studying one central question:
Why does the body keep reacting long after the danger is over?
As the former Medical Director of the Trauma Center in Boston and a leading voice in trauma science, he has been at the forefront of groundbreaking research on PTSD, dissociation, and the nervous system.
His work helped prove something most people were never taught:
Trauma is not just a psychological wound.
It is a physical imprint - stored in the brain, the body, and the nervous system.
His bestselling book “The Body Keeps the Score” became an international phenomenon, translated worldwide and read by millions, because it finally put words on what so many people experience but can’t explain.
But Bessel didn’t stop at understanding trauma.
He spent decades exploring what actually helps people recover - from EMDR to movement, yoga, breathwork, theatre, body-based practices, and nervous system regulation.
